The Dangers of Adware and Malware

Malicious software and adware are major dangers to your online life. A terrible surfing experience is typically the result of adware, which bombards visitors with intrusive adverts. The slowdown of your device’s performance is an additional inconvenience.

Even more sinister is malware. It has the potential to destroy data, steal personal information, or take over your machine for evil intentions. These tools are used by cybercriminals to obtain unauthorized access by exploiting software flaws.

Beyond the obvious consequences on your device, an infection can have far-reaching consequences. Many victims confront the serious risks of identity theft and financial ruin as a result of these assaults.

Plus, adware is a common entry point for more serious malware attacks. It allows additional harmful apps to sneak into your system undetected after it’s installed.

In our highly-connected world, where every click counts, it is essential to stay knowledgeable about these threats. If you want to keep yourself safe when using the internet, you need to be alert and take precautions before anything bad happens.

How Adsy.pw/hb3 Spreads and Infects Devices

Deceptive approaches are usually used to disseminate Adsy.pw/hb3. Clicking on deceptive advertising or links causes users to unintentionally download it. These can fool you into thinking they are authentic.

Bundled software installs are another typical technique. People may unknowingly consent to install extra undesirable applications like Adsy.pw/hb3 when they download free apps or programs.

Its dissemination is also heavily influenced by phishing emails. Even a seemingly benign email might have links that secretly install adware on your computer.

Once Adsy.pw/hb3 is installed, it starts interfering with the device’s usual functionality. It redirects traffic and creates annoying pop-ups, making web navigation risky and annoying at best.

If you want to defend yourself against this invading danger, you must be aware of how it spreads. Users may make more educated judgments when visiting the web if they understand how it infiltrates devices.

Signs that Your Device is Infected with Adsy.pw/hb3

In order to keep your device secure from an Adsy.pw/hb3 infection, you must be able to recognize its signals. An increase in intrusive pop-up advertising is a common symptom. Ads popping up all the time, even while you’re not using the internet, might be an indication of trouble.

Slow performance is another red flag. Malware can be hiding in the background if your device begins to lag or applications launch more slowly than normal.

Unexpected redirections are another potential issue you could face when browsing the web. This implies that, instead of going to the desired destination, clicking on links will send you to unknown sites.

Other warning signs to look out for include frequent system crashes or freezes when running the program. If your system is experiencing these interruptions, it means that something is wrong.

If you notice that your browser has changed its settings or added new toolbars, it can be a sign that Adsy.pw/hb3 has invaded your privacy and is controlling your web experience. Keep a close eye out for these symptoms; they usually indicate an infection that needs to be treated right once.

Steps to Remove Adsy.pw/hb3 from Your Device

A methodical approach is necessary to remove Adsy.pw/hb3 from your device. To begin, go into the settings menu on your device. Discover the area that is devoted to apps or programs that are already installed.

After that, find any questionable programs that you have no recollection of installing. They may be associated with the adware, so uninstall them right away.

Next, launch an antivirus scan that you trust. To get the best results, keep it current. This program can identify Adsy.pw/hb3-related harmful files and delete them.

Make sure you also clear your browser’s cache and history. By doing so, you may remove all trace of those pesky advertising from your browser’s history.

Turn your browser back to its factory settings. By doing this, you may be confident that your browser is clean and secure going forward, since no hidden extensions will be active.

Tips for Avoiding Adware and Malware in the Future

Being proactive is key to keeping your device safe. To begin, make sure your OS and applications are up-to-date at all times. Malware vulnerabilities are often patched by these upgrades.

After that, make sure you have trustworthy antivirus software. Before they can do any harm, an effective software will identify potential dangers. For an extra degree of safety, turn on real-time protection.

When you download anything from the internet, be careful. Keep to legitimate channels, such as the App Store or Google Play. Keep away from phishing efforts and other strange links in emails and texts; they might lead to adware.

You may also install add-ons for your browser that will prevent advertisements and trackers. Both your surfing speed and your exposure to hazardous information will be improved by this.

Make it a habit to learn new things about being safe when using the internet. Your ability to successfully manage possible dangers is directly proportional to the amount of information you have.
